WebThis resistance to flow is defined by an equation of the form: P = K p Q n (eq.4) Where P = pressure drop inches of water (inches w.g.). Q = airflow in cu. ft/min (CFM). K = a constant determined by the characteristics of the system. n = a constant depending upon the type of flow. p = density of air in lb. per cubic foot.

WebJan 21, 2016 · When designing a blower-based system, it is important to understand the concept of pressure drop, how it affects blower performance, and how system design affects it. Pressure drop is the difference in pressure from one point in a system to another. ...
